The Catalyst
The catalyst for today's rally is a response to a short sell report by Wolfpack Research. The report highlighted potential tax issues for U.S. shareholders due to Poet's status as a Passive Foreign Investment Company (PFIC). However, Poet has taken proactive measures to address this concern. The company plans to provide information that will allow U.S. shareholders to make a qualified-electing-fund (QEF) election, effectively mitigating the tax complications.

The Impact on Shareholders
Today's rally is a testament to the market's positive response to Poet's proactive measures. Investors are clearly relieved by the potential resolution of tax issues. With a 35% year-to-date gain, Poet's stock is attracting attention. However, it's important to note that the company's valuation is still quite high, trading at approximately 130 times this year's expected sales.
